STRATEGY UNPACKED: How Mercedes got Russell on the podium in Spain from P12 on the grid

Barcelona saw Mercedes get both drivers on the podium for the first time this season, allowing them to take second position in the constructors' championship from Aston Martin. What is even more impressive is that this was managed from George Russell’s starting position of P12.
The much talked about Mercedes upgrade package may have stolen the show but it's not the only reason they made it to the podium, as former Aston Martin strategist Bernie Collins explains...
